In recent decades, authors affiliated with Zakład Doświadczalny Instytutu Zootechniki have published 307 papers, which have received a total of 1.6k indexed citations. Scholars at this organization have produced 104 papers in Plant Science, 79 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 70 papers in Animal Science and Zoology on the topics of Agriculture, Plant Science, Crop Management (63 papers), Nutrition and Health Studies (60 papers) and Agricultural economics and policies (55 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Animal Science and Zoology (654 citations), Plant Science (411 citations) and Molecular Biology (249 citations). Authors at Zakład Doświadczalny Instytutu Zootechniki collaborate with scholars in Poland, United States and France and have published in prestigious journals including Nature, Experimental Cell Research and Phytochemistry. Some of Zakład Doświadczalny Instytutu Zootechniki's most productive authors include Jan Burczyk, J. Koreleski, Z. Smorąg, Krzysztof Żyła, M. Pietras, Sylwester Świątkiewicz, Samo Bobek, D.R. Ledoux, Jacek P. Dworzański and Marek Jastrzębski.
